Personalized Value Metrics

Meaning ● Personalized Value Metrics represent the quantifiable measures that reflect the unique benefits a Small and Medium-sized Business (SMB) provides to its individual customers. These metrics extend beyond generic KPIs, focusing instead on how specific product features, service interactions, or automated processes address the particular needs and expectations of each customer segment within the SMB’s operational framework. As SMBs scale, automation can play a crucial role in gathering and analyzing data to construct these bespoke metrics. This data-driven approach enables businesses to more effectively tailor their offerings, improving customer satisfaction and retention.
Scope ● In the sphere of SMB Growth, the application of Personalized Value Metrics guides strategic decision-making, impacting product development, marketing strategies, and sales processes. With implementation, it allows for precise adjustments to operational workflows and customer engagement strategies, facilitated by automated systems. Specifically, metrics might track how efficiently automated customer service chatbots resolve individual inquiries or how personalized email campaigns increase conversion rates among distinct customer groups. Ultimately, such metrics ensure that the SMB’s investments in automation directly translate into enhanced, individualized customer value, fueling sustainable growth, and fostering stronger customer relationships.
